WebJun 3, 2024 · Here, logs were rough cut into boards and then sent down the creek by way of a flume to the planing mill. The flume bypass waterfalls, crossing the creek several times on its way down to the mill. Over a million feet of lumber came down the flume over the years before the operation closed down due to a fire in 1937. Webdiminishes, the bypass air damper opens, reducing the lab exhaust flow and adding ambient air to the reduced lab exhaust flow. The added bypass air assists in the dispersion of hazardous lab effluent while maintaining constant fan discharge flow, velocity, and plume rise. WebThe elevated nature of the Montana flume exacerbates this problem. In earthen channels, upstream bypass may occur and downstream scour will occur unless the channel is armored.and downstream scour may occur. Montana flumes smaller than 3 inches in size should not be used on unscreened sanitary flows, due to the likelihood of clogging. [10]
